Output e15f5886236a1a463b9159e662a1424aa97973282bbd4d7e2e282c84632f7356:134

value
69033
script pubkey
OP_0 OP_PUSHBYTES_20 e1646f6868093d1e2861952fd48c9a55e0b60ba3
address
bc1qu9jx76rgpy73u2rpj5hafry62hstvzarxq5wnu
transaction
e15f5886236a1a463b9159e662a1424aa97973282bbd4d7e2e282c84632f7356